What is claimed is:
1. A spinal cord stimulation system comprising:
an implantable pulse generator;
a plurality of electrodes for delivering electrical pulses to a patient;
a plurality of leads connecting the plurality of electrodes to the implantable pulse generator;
an anchor for maintaining at least one of the plurality of leads in a desired position within the patient, wherein the anchor includes a sleeve; and
a locking block configured to be received into the sleeve
wherein the locking block includes a blocking screw and a locking screw, wherein the locking screw includes a cam portion to impinge at least one of the plurality of lead in a locked position and is further configured to engage the blocking screw in an unlocked position.
2. The spinal cord stimulation system of claim 1 , wherein the anchor comprises a center lumen for receiving at least one of the plurality of leads therein.
3. The spinal cord stimulation system of claim 1 , wherein the locking block comprises a locking screw for engaging at least one of the plurality of leads therein.
4. The spinal cord stimulation system of claim 3 , wherein the locking screw comprises a threaded portion and a cam portion.
5. The spinal cord stimulation system of claim 1 , wherein the locking block comprises a locking screw and a blocking screw.
6. The spinal cord stimulation system of claim 5 , wherein the locking screw comprises a threaded portion and a cam portion.
7. The spinal cord stimulation system of claim 1 , wherein the anchor comprises one or more eyelets for receiving a suture therein.
8. The spinal cord stimulation system of claim 7 , wherein the anchor comprises one or more suture surfaces for engaging a suture.
9. The spinal cord stimulation system of claim 1 , wherein the anchor is configured to receive a multi-lumen lead.

The spinal cord stimulation system of claim 1 , wherein the locking block includes a blocking screw and a locking screw, wherein the locking screw includes a cam portion to impinge at least one of the plurality of lead in a locked position and further configured to engage the blocking screw in an unlocked position.
11. The spinal cord stimulation system of claim 10 , wherein the locking screw includes an upper threaded portion and is configured to be downwardly threaded into a threaded receiver of the anchor.
12. The spinal cord stimulation system of claim 11 , wherein the blocking screw is configured to prevent back out of the locking screw from the threaded receiver.
13. The spinal cord stimulation system of claim 12 , wherein the cam portion engages the blocking screw when rotated approximately 180 degrees relative to the locked position.
